Consumer Description
On multiple occasions I have had driver assistance system failures with the most recent occurring this past Saturday 8/2/25, which I have on dashcam. In this incident, I had adaptive cruise control set to short following distance. I had about 5 or 6 car lengths in front of me at highway speed and the lead car was far enough ahead that the car was not showing it on the interactive display. Another car changed lanes from the right to left in front of me right behind the lead vehicle. The car that changed lanes was not detected by the vehicle even though it was right in front of me. I was approaching the vehicle at a higher rate of speed and the car never attempted to slow eventually requiring me to depress the brake to cancel the cruise as the car was not responding to the fact that I was now right behind the car and had to brake to avoid a collision. On a separate incident a month or so ago, I was entering a center turn lane, waiting to turn into a gas station which required crossing of 2 lanes of traffic in the opposite direction. As I was entering the center lane with my signal on, the car detected the opposing traffic and slammed on the breaks nearly causing me to get rear-ended by the traffic behind me that expected me to enter the turn lane at the rate of speed I was going. Routinely, the car fails to detect vehicles in the blind spot. I can approach, pass, and clear a vehicle on the left (vehicle to my right) and the car will never detect that a car was there in the first place. Additionally, if a car is detected and then stays in the blind spot long enough, the car loses it and thinks the car is no longer in the blind spot.
